SelectPlusInt'l Aid May Soon Reach Cyclone VictimsInt'l Aid May Soon Reach Cyclone VictimsThe Associated PressThe U N says more than a million Myanmar cyclone victims will be able to receive their first assistance if the country's military regime quickly allows foreign experts into the affected areas. (May 26)[Notes:ANCHOR VOICE] MYANMAR SAYS IT'S READY TO ACCEPT INTERNATIONAL AID FOR CYCLONE VICTIMS - BUT ONLY WITh STRINGS ATTACHED.DONOR NATIONS SAY THEY'RE READY TO PROVIDE 100 MILLION DOLLARS FOR RECOVERY - BUT ONLY IF THEY GET UNFETTERED ACCESS TO CYCLONE SURVIVORS.THERE HAVE BEEN RUMORS THAT THE GOVERNMENT HAS ALREADY CONFISCATED SOME OF THE HUMANITARIAN SUPPLIES SENT TO THE SOUTH ASIAN NATION. [Notes:11. SOUNDBITE: (English) Richard Gordon, Chairman of International Federation of Red Cross and Red Crescent Societies:]"What is important now is to facilitate through the ASEAN nations the ability to be able to bring in as much as possible, (in a) fast and efficient way and a focused way in reaching of the suffering community out there especially in the deltas." MYANMAR'S ISOLATIONIST GOVERNMENT SAYS IT WILL ONLY ALLOW CIVILIAN AID INTO THE COUNTRY IF IT TRAVELS A SPECIFIC ROUTE. BUT U-S-, BRITISH, AND FRENCH WARSHIPS HAVE BEEN LOADED UP WITH HUMANITARIAN SUPPLIES AND FLOATING OFF THE THE COAST OF THE DEVASTATED SOUTH ASIAN NATION FOR MORE THAN A WEEK. [Notes:13. SOUNDBITE: (English) Richard Gordon, Chairman of International Federation of Red Cross and Red Crescent Societies:] There'll be baby steps, there will be insecurity every step of the way, on the one side the assertion that this is not a political game that we played; that there is political debate (that) must be undertaken, that must be clear to the Myanmar authorities."MYANMAR'S MILITARY GOVERNMENT FEARS FOREIGN INTERFERENCE IN ITS INTERNAL POLITICS. BUT THERE ARE 78,000 PEOPLE DEAD; 56,000 PEOPLE MISSING AND 2.4 MILLION SURVIVORS.
